    I may be wrong, but I don't think it's quite fair to call Isla 'trendy'. Sure, it is talked about quite often on these naming boards, and yes it made a jump from not being in the top 1,000 to being in the 600's. . .but does that make it trendy? 600s are still pretty low on the popularity charts. The fact that Isla is so popular on these boards doesn't worry me all that much (my daughter's name is Isla by the way!) because I think a lot of people who consider Isla wont actually use it and also a lot of people that have the name on their favorite list aren't actually even pregnant - -just love names. Of course when the top 1000 of 2009 is released I may be proved wrong, if Isla is now in the 400's or something. I am no expert but I really don't see Isla ever making the top 100 and certainly not the top 20. At least I hope:)

    Perceptions of popularity are a weird thing. There are still lots of girls being born named Jennifer and Nicole, far more than many trendy names. Even Linda is still around #500. Yes, they were more common once, but they are far more in use than you'd guess from these boards. Several people have mentioned Julia as a dated name, though it's never been uncommon.

    I wouldn't be surprised to see Isla on the top 10 for 2020.
